I have a heavily modded Skyrim LE and SE (600+ and 500+) and recently after doing a reinstall for Windows 10 because of a bad update I had to redownload most of my programs. I downloaded Vortex and everything appeared perfectly normal the only thing I had to do was rezip the Mods back up and just drag them back into Vortex and tada. My saves were good, my games running smoothly, no CTD's, all my mods were exactly as they were before. Now I am getting told to "Purge" because it was another instance of Vortex. Now here's my problem, last time I did this it indeed destroyed my Skyrim LE and really drove me insane because of me having to go through a lot of different fomods and figure out what the hell I selected for each one and how I did everything it's exhausting, taxing mentally, and down right insanity. I don't WANT to purge because everything is fine and exactly how I WANT it, this is the ONLY mod manager I have seen ever do this so why am I being spammed constantly for something that seems perfectly fine right now. Do I have to just never install an Fomod ever again now? I refuse to purge because of the negative experience I had with it in the past. Is there really NO way to disable or say "No" and just reinstall a damn mod anyways so I can choose something else?

Vortex is a mod manager. It expects to be managing your mods and wants to restore a state where it can actually manage your mods.

 

By reinstalling Vortex and not backing up the vortex data, you deleted all the information Vortex had about which mods it had installed. What you have in your game directory is the last mod setup that you created and it can't be changed anymore.

 

If you are fine with that and just want to play that setup, that's fine, but then you don't need Vortex just play your game.

If you want Vortex to just install mods on top of that setup you can do that too (irreversible): delete the vortex.deployment files in your Skyrim and Skyrim\data directories (for both games) and then Vortex won't be able to purge those mods and won't ask

 

But the only way Vortex can manage the mods you currently have in your game directory is if you purge and reinstall them and that is what Vortex assumes you want.
